Warning Signs You Need Thermal Imaging Leak Detection
Beware of these warning signs that show you need thermal imaging leak detection: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your home can show a hidden leak. Don’t ignore these smells, they can be a sign of a larger issue.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Discoloration or warping on your ceilings and walls can show water damage. Our thermal imaging technology can detect hidden leaks before they cause costly repairs.
Increased Water Bills
Unexpected spikes in your water bills can show a hidden leak. Don’t ignore these increases, they can add up quickly.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age. Our team can help you detect and fix hidden leaks before they cause further damage.
Unexplained Noises
Unusual noises, such as dripping or running water, can show a hidden leak. Don’t ignore these sounds, they can be a sign of a larger issue.
High Humidity Levels
Unusually high humidity levels can show a hidden leak. Our thermal imaging technology can detect these issues before they cause costly repairs.

Common Questions About Thermal Imaging Leak Detection
Q: What is thermal imaging leak detection?
Thermal imaging leak detection is a non-invasive method of detecting hidden leaks in your home or building. Our team uses specialized cameras to detect temperature changes, showing where water may be seeping into your walls or ceilings.
Q: How long does a thermal imaging leak detection inspection take?
A thermal imaging leak detection inspection typ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the size of the affected area and the complexity of the issue.
